CNMI positive total at 185

The CNMI’s total number of COVID-19 cases went up by one to 185 yesterday after one additional person tested positive. The individual was identified through travel screening and confirmed diagnosis through testing on arrival on July 7. According to a Commonwealth Healthcare Corp....

McDonald’s to host inaugural golf tourney

McDonald’s of Guam & Saipan is hosting a golf tournament this December to raise funds for Ronald McDonald House Charities, a non-profit that provides a home-away-from-home for seriously ill children and their families. The Inaugural Ronald McDonald House Charities Golf...

$10K hole-in-one at HANMI Charity Golf tourney

There’s now $10,000 up for grabs as a hole-in-one prize at the 19th Annual HANMI Charity Classic Golf Tournament on Aug. 14, 2021, at Coral Ocean Resort in Saipan. “The response from our sponsors has been very encouraging, and we’re pleased to offer $10,000 as a hole-in-one prize...

Eco Camp starts Monday

Eco Camp will run at the Marianas Trekking Adventure Center in Marpi beginning Monday, July 12. “This will be our 22nd year offering activities to our local community,” said Marianas Trekking manager Jojo Valencia. “We are going to go on some great hikes and field trips along...
